## Ownership

The SQL linting rules in `lint/sqlrules/` enforce naming conventions, forbid implicit cross joins, and require explicit column lists in inserts. They run in CI via the Quillcheck stage and locally through `make lint-sql`. New team members: don't disable a rule without filing a proposal first — exceptions live in `lint/exceptions.yml` with a justification. Rule changes and exception requests are reviewed and approved by the owner listed below.

account owner for bawip-tahag: Raleth Quenok

Subject: Handover — WikiGate perms

Hey Tomas,

Quick handover before you start: WikiGate's role-based access is mostly stable, but contractors sometimes get stuck in the "viewer" role after onboarding. If that happens, don't edit the role table directly — just file a perms ticket. For anything weird with group sync, reach the access team here.

escalation mailbox, bafog-fafog: ulador@paliqlabs.internal

Quarterly Planning Note — Second-Source Search

Q3 priority: qualify a second supplier for the Ferline pump assembly. Current sole source, Drassen Components, has missed two delivery windows. Candidates under audit: Quillbrook Engineering and Marlowe Fabrication. Sample parts due week four; qualification decision week ten. Branch managers: flag any inventory exposure by Friday. The confidential planning note below applies.

internal memo for yahag-tahog: The pricing group signed off on a budget of $152.8 million for Project Soriel.

**Q: What data does the nightly reconciliation job in Ledgermoss access?**

The job reads stock counts from the warehouse replica and write-locks only the adjustments table. It runs under a dedicated service account with no interactive login, and every correction is recorded with a before/after pair for audit. Its permission grants and rotation schedule are described on the internal page.

runbook for tafof-yawif: https://confluence.tolvaqsys.internal/display/display/browse/pages/7be3

**Vendor note: Inkmill markdown pipeline**

Rendering for Parchway docs is outsourced to Inkmill under an annual contract, renewing each March. They handle sanitization and PDF export; we own the upload queue. SLA: 4-hour response on rendering failures. Escalate only after two failed retries. Their support desk is reachable at the address below.

billing contact of hahaf-baguf = zorael.tammir.jorius@sivrelhq.internal